Tony Duggan notes, of Andre Previn:

>The Queen recently awarded him an Honorary Knighthood which shows how
>highly regarded he is here.

Some recent newspapers ads trumpeting Andre Previn's upcoming appearances
(playing jazz) in Kansas City, refer to him as 'Sir Andre Previn', which
is offensive to many Americans.  He's an American citizen, has never been
a British citizen, and by law and custom Americans cannot be designated
'Sir'.  We're anti-royalist democracy, don't you know.  'All men are
created equal.' I suppose the ad writers must think that people will be
impressed by the title.
